What types of editing services do you offer?
We provide a range of editing services, including developmental editing, line editing, copy editing, and proofreading. Developmental editing focuses on big-picture elements like structure and content; line editing evaluates each line and paragraph to ensure effectiveness; copy editing addresses grammar, style, and accuracy; and proofreading ensures your manuscript is free of typographical errors.

How does the editing process work?
You submit a draft of your manuscript in Microsoft Word. Your editor reviews and edits using Track Changes before sending back to you. You review and either approve, reject, or provide your own revisions, then submit the manuscript back to your editor to address any lingering issues before finalizing the draft.
